Introduction:

In the current f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 work schedule no longer pertains to many households. Using rise of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are solutions has-been ste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ities provide moms and dads the flexibleness they must balance work and household responsibilities, and provide a secure and nurturing environment for children around-the-clock.

Among cr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are is the mobility it provides working parents. Numerous moms and dads work changes that increase beyond standard daycare hours, making it difficult to acquire childcare that meets their rout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this issue by giving treatment during nights, vacations, plus in a single day. This allows parents to operate without fretting about finding someone to view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it offers to parents. Knowing that their children are increasingly being cared for by trained specialists in a secure and secure environment can alleviate the tension and guilt that often is sold with making young ones in daycare. Moms and dads can concentrate on their work realizing that kids have been in good fingers, that may induce increased output and job satisfaction.

In addition, 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a feeling of neighborhood and assistance for people.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ide advantages, they even incorporate their own set of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and trustworthy childcare providers who're prepared to work non-traditional hours could be tough, leading to high return prices and possible staffing shortages. This will probably affect the grade of care provided to children and create uncertainty for families rel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the cost. Offering attention night and day calls for additional staffing and resources, that could drive up the price of services. This could be a barrier for low-income people just who may not be capable pay for 24-hour daycare, making these with limited al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

In order to make sure the safety and well-being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and supervision are essential. State and neighborhood governing bodies set standards for licensing and accreditation of daycare centers, including those that work around the clock. These criteria c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health demands, and staff training and skills.

And federal government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ities elect to seek accreditation from nationwide organizations for instance the nationwide Association for Education of Young Children (NAEYC) or the nationwide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a commitment to top-notch attention and that can help parents feel confident inside their range of childcare supplier.
